Parasitic infections in the intestine are surprisingly common, affecting people of all ages. They often go unnoticed until symptoms become uncomfortable or severe. These infections can lead to bloating, stomach pain, fatigue, nausea, poor appetite, and other digestive issues. While prescription medications are effective, they sometimes cause side effects such as nausea, dizziness, or disruption of gut flora. Fortunately, there are natural dietary approaches that can help combat intestinal worms, supporting both treatment and prevention. Incorporating specific foods into your daily routine can serve as a gentle yet powerful tool to cleanse your digestive system.

Carrots are among the most effective foods for targeting intestinal parasites. Their fiber-rich content helps move food efficiently through the digestive tract, reducing the environment in which worms thrive. Consuming two grated carrots daily can aid in flushing out worms while nourishing the gut with essential vitamins and antioxidants. Beyond killing parasites, carrots strengthen the immune system and support overall digestive health, making them a simple yet potent natural remedy for maintaining intestinal balance. For best results, raw carrots are preferred, as cooking may reduce some of their beneficial properties.

Lemon and mint are two additional natural allies in the fight against intestinal worms. Lemon’s high acidity creates a hostile environment for parasites, while its vitamin C content strengthens the immune system. Mint, on the other hand, contains compounds that help relax the digestive tract and reduce inflammation. Combining lemon juice, peppermint juice, and a pinch of salt in a glass of water creates a cleansing mixture that can be consumed daily. This blend works not only to combat existing infections but also to discourage re-infestation, making it an easy and effective addition to a parasite-conscious diet.

Coconut is another versatile food that aids in eliminating intestinal worms. Its natural oils and fibers have lubricating properties that can help expel parasites from the digestive system. Eating fresh coconut or drinking coconut water daily for a week can assist in cleansing the gut while providing hydration and essential nutrients. Coconut also contains lauric acid, known for its antimicrobial properties, which can help support overall gut health. Incorporating coconut into meals or snacks provides a tasty and nutritious way to enhance intestinal cleansing and reduce parasite populations naturally.

Other foods that have demonstrated antiparasitic effects include garlic, pumpkin seeds, and papaya seeds. Garlic contains allicin, a compound with strong antimicrobial and antifungal properties that can target worms directly. Pumpkin seeds are rich in cucurbitacin, which can paralyze parasites, allowing the body to expel them more easily. Papaya seeds have enzymes such as papain that help break down intestinal worms while improving digestion. Combining these foods with a balanced diet high in fiber, fresh fruits, and vegetables strengthens the gut microbiome, further reducing the risk of parasitic infections over time.

In addition to dietary interventions, maintaining good hygiene and a clean living environment is essential to prevent reinfection. Washing hands regularly, cleaning fruits and vegetables thoroughly, and avoiding contaminated water or raw foods in high-risk areas can significantly reduce exposure to parasites. While natural foods are effective adjuncts, severe infestations may still require medical evaluation and prescription treatments.
